Solution for (8-5x)(8+5x)= equation:


Simplifying
(8 + -5x)(8 + 5x) = 0

Multiply (8 + -5x) * (8 + 5x)
(8(8 + 5x) + -5x * (8 + 5x)) = 0
((8 * 8 + 5x * 8) + -5x * (8 + 5x)) = 0
((64 + 40x) + -5x * (8 + 5x)) = 0
(64 + 40x + (8 * -5x + 5x * -5x)) = 0
(64 + 40x + (-40x + -25x2)) = 0

Combine like terms: 40x + -40x = 0
(64 + 0 + -25x2) = 0
(64 + -25x2) = 0

Solving
64 + -25x2 = 0

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-64' to each side of the equation.
64 + -64 + -25x2 = 0 + -64

Combine like terms: 64 + -64 = 0
0 + -25x2 = 0 + -64
-25x2 = 0 + -64

Combine like terms: 0 + -64 = -64
-25x2 = -64

Divide each side by '-25'.
x2 = 2.56

Simplifying
x2 = 2.56

Take the square root of each side:
x = {-1.6, 1.6}
